What does Robinson do?

Robinson PLC is a successful British company that has been involved in the production and processing of paper for over 180 years. The company's history dates back to 1845 when businessman William Robinson acquired a paper mill in Walthamstow, England. Since then, the company has become one of the leading paper manufacturers in the United Kingdom and Europe, offering a wide range of standard papers and customized solutions for specific requirements. Their products include high-quality printing papers, packaging materials, hygiene papers, and specialty papers for the medical and automotive industries. Robinson PLC serves both businesses and end consumers. The company operates in various sectors, with "paper manufacturing" being its core business, encompassing all processes related to paper production, including pulp production, paper manufacturing, and product refinement. The "packaging" sector plays a significant role, producing specialized packaging materials for different industries, prioritizing sustainable materials and eco-friendly production methods. In addition to these sectors, Robinson PLC also offers a comprehensive range of office supplies under the Q-Connect brand, known for its high-quality products at affordable prices. Over the years, Robinson PLC has been at the forefront of innovation, introducing paper recycling to the UK and becoming one of the country's largest recycling paper manufacturers. The company is also committed to sustainability, aiming to use 100% recycled or sustainably produced paper by 2025. ROCE Details

Unraveling Robinson's Return on Capital Employed (ROCE)

Robinson's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) is a financial metric that measures the company's profitability and efficiency with respect to the capital employed. It is calculated by dividing earnings before interest and tax (EBIT) by the employed capital. A higher ROCE indicates that the company is effectively utilizing its capital to generate profits.

Year-to-Year Comparison

Analyzing Robinson's ROCE annually provides valuable insights into its efficiency in using its capital to generate profits. An increasing ROCE indicates improved profitability and operational efficiency, whereas a decrease might signal potential issues in capital utilization or business operations.

Impact on Investments

Robinson's ROCE is a critical factor for investors and analysts for evaluating the company’s efficiency and profitability. A higher ROCE can make the company an attractive investment, as it often signifies that the firm is generating adequate profits from its employed capital.

Interpreting ROCE Fluctuations

Changes in Robinson’s ROCE are attributed to variations in EBIT or the capital employed. These fluctuations offer insights into the company’s operational efficiency, financial performance, and strategic financial management, assisting investors in making informed investment decisions.

Stock savings plans offer an attractive way for investors to build wealth over the long term. One of the main advantages is the so-called cost-average effect: by regularly investing a fixed amount in stocks or stock funds, you automatically buy more shares when prices are low, and fewer when they are high. This can lead to a more favorable average price per share over time. In addition, stock savings plans allow small investors access to expensive stocks, as they can participate with small amounts. Regular investment also promotes a disciplined investment strategy and helps to avoid emotional decisions, such as impulsive buying or selling. Furthermore, investors benefit from the potential appreciation of the stocks as well as from dividend distributions, which can be reinvested, enhancing the compounding effect and thus the growth of the invested capital.
